EventManager was a commercial event management app, developed, licensed, and supported by UK-based Kent House based at Keele University. [1]
The product was first developed in 2003 for use within the UK National Health Service (NHS). It was adopted widely within the NHS and also by commercial and not-for profit organisations to support their event management activity.[citation needed]
In 2008 EventManager won a Medilink West Midlands award[2] for its contribution to delivering efficiencies in the NHS.[citation needed]
EventManager was featured as a case study in The Internet Case Study Book[3] published in 2010 by Taschen.[citation needed]
The product is no longer available.[citation needed]
